def is_cvm(node: Any) -> bool:
"""
Returns True if the node is provisioned as a Confidential VM.

Falls back to False when the platform does not expose a SecurityProfile
feature (e.g. ready / hyperv platforms), so callers can use this as a
guard without extra checks.
"""
try:
settings = Feature.get_feature_settings(
node.features[SecurityProfile].get_settings()
)
except Exception:
return False
return (
isinstance(settings, SecurityProfileSettings)
and settings.security_profile == SecurityProfileType.CVM
)

# CVMs do not surface emulated input devices or framebuffer/DRM over VMBus,
# so the corresponding kernel modules are intentionally absent in CVMs.
# Reference:
# https://elixir.bootlin.com/linux/v7.0/source/drivers/hv/channel_mgmt.c#L31
# In the above file only modules with ".allowed_in_isolated = true," are available
# in CVMs.
# Below are modules that are not exposed to a guest when running as a Confidential VM.
# These modules should be skipped in checks for module presence and in reload tests on
# CVMs.

_CVM_UNAVAILABLE_MODULES = frozenset(
{
"hid_hyperv",
"hyperv_keyboard",
"hyperv_fb",
"hyperv_drm",
}
)
